I disagree that it's about individuals, it's more about what players we have in what positions.....
The team struggles when we play 2 wingers and Howson/Killa because neither Howson nor Killkenny are good at shielding the defence. As much as I do not rate Johnson Killkenny looks a different player with him and Howson in as he doesn't have to work back as much, this also helps out our frail defence and we look a much better team. The issue then is to drop Max or Snoddy, and this is where Grayson has had issues as I don't think he likes to drop either which then means he has to dick about with the 3 central midfielders. Drop Johnson and we ship goals, drop Snoddy / Max and we lose out on the supply for Beccio's taps ins. Now we get to Beccio....I don't rate him, I'll be honest, but I think combined with the wingers we have he will always score plenty because he's good at anticipating those crosses and through balls, however, his style of play stifles any other sort of attacking momentum, too many times he can't control a pass or dwells too long on the ball, and contrary to common belief, he can't knock a ball on with his head. As far scoring record, Max scored 2 less goals in the same amount of games....from the wing...and Somma scored 12 in very limited game time. What I would do in the summer, assuming Killa goes, is to find a good defensive midfielder with some creativity to screen the back 4 and create chances, problem is that's probably a player that would cost >£3mill. I'd keep Beccio but rotate more between him, McCormack and Somma.
